The present invention relates to a neck base, which is small in volume and easy to store and carry, and is excellent in wearability.

Generally, the cushion for the neck support is made to be able to relieve fatigue by stably supporting the left, right and rear parts of the neck by wearing it on the user's neck when driving at home, at work or driving.

As shown in FIG. 1, the conventional neck support cushion 1 is formed in a substantially 'C' shape and has a structure in which a cushion material such as cotton or sponge is embedded inside the cover.

Conventionally, the cushion for a neck support 1 has a bulky cushion material such as a cotton or a sponge which is bulky inside the cover, which is bulky when moved and inconvenient to carry, which is not easy to store.

Korean Patent No. 10-1478499

The present invention has been proposed in order to solve the above-described problems, and it is an object of the present invention to provide a slit-shaped flexible main body member and a flexible sheet-like stretchable cover member, The purpose is to provide a pedestal.

In order to achieve the above object, the present invention provides a cover member comprising a flexible plate-like body member and a flexible sheet-like cover member surrounding the body member, and a cover member provided on the cover member spaced apart from both sides in the longitudinal direction, A connecting member; A neck brace is provided which is wound around a neck and is worn by connecting connecting members provided on both sides in the longitudinal direction.

Here, the body member may have a plurality of slits spaced from each other along the longitudinal direction at the upper portion thereof, and a plurality of upper protrusions may be formed on the body member, and a plurality of slits may be formed along the longitudinal direction at the lower portion thereof. The cover portion is an elastic material and is made of a more flexible material than the body member.

In the above, on both sides in the longitudinal direction of the lower portion of the body member, a downward protruding lower protrusion is provided; And is formed in a shape having a large width at the portion where the lower protrusion is formed than the center portion.

Since the neck base according to the present invention has a small volume and can be folded, it is easy to store and carry, and a flexible plate-like body member has a plurality of protrusions formed on the upper and lower portions along the longitudinal direction, Since the cover member made of an elastic material covers the protrusions, the deformation of the body member is elastically supported by the elasticity, so that the wearability is improved when worn. In addition, there is a lifting effect that pulls the neck up and down when worn.

The upper part of the cover member does not flow down and the lower part does not rise by the body member when worn, and the neck part is elastically supported by the cover member.

The neck base 100 according to the present invention comprises a body member 110, a cover member 130 surrounding the body member 110, and a connecting member 150.

In the body member 110  .

The body member 110 is provided in a plate shape. The body member 110 is formed in a substantially rectangular shape having a longitudinal length longer than a width. The edge of the body member 110 may be formed in a round shape.

The body member 110 is made of flexible natural rubber or soft synthetic resin. The body member 110 may be made of soft PVC or EVA resin. For example, soft PVC mixed with a plasticizer mixed with a tensile weight of, for example, 40 to 80 parts by weight, 100 parts by weight of a vinyl chloride resin (Polyvinyl Chloride) may be used. The thickness of the body member 110 is preferably in the range of 1 to 3 mm.

As shown in FIGS. 2 and 4, a slit 111a extending downward from the upper end of the body member 110 is formed. The slits 111a are spaced apart from each other in the longitudinal direction to form a plurality of slits 111a. And the upper end is formed in an incised shape by the slit 111a. By forming the plurality of slits 111a, a plurality of upper protrusions are formed on the upper portion of the body member 110. FIG. The slit 111a may be formed to have a deeper depth from both end portions in the longitudinal direction to the center in the longitudinal direction. Portions separated by the slits 111a may be in contact with each other or may be spaced apart from each other.

Since the upper end of the body member 100 is formed by the plurality of slits 111a, deformation can be facilitated when an external force acts upon the body member 100 when worn.

A slit 111b extending upward from the lower end of the body member 110 is also formed. The slits 111b are formed in a plurality of spaced apart along the length direction. And the lower end is formed in an incised shape by the slit 111b. By forming the plurality of slits 111b, a plurality of lower protrusions are formed in the lower portion of the body member 110. [ The slit 111b may be formed so as to have a deeper depth from both end portions in the longitudinal direction to the center in the longitudinal direction. Portions separated by the slits 111b may be in contact with each other or may be spaced apart from each other.

Since the lower end of the body member 110 is cut by the plurality of slits 111b, deformation is facilitated when an external force acts upon the body member 110 when worn.

The lower end of the slit 111a formed on the upper portion is spaced apart from the upper end of the slit 111b formed in the lower portion in the vertical direction. The slits 111b and 111a may be formed at positions shifted from each other in the lengthwise direction or in parallel with each other.

The slits 111a and 111b are formed on the upper and lower portions of the body member 110 to facilitate the deformation of the upper and lower portions of the body member 110 when worn. The slits 111a and 111b are formed to be free from deformation and the body member 110 is supported by the elasticity of the cover member 130. Therefore, do.

And a lower protrusion 113 protruding downward from a part of the longitudinal direction of the body member 110 in the longitudinal direction. The lower protrusions 113 provided at both ends in the longitudinal direction are spaced apart from each other.

The lower protrusion 113 is provided in a downwardly extended form. By the provision of the lower protrusion 113, the body member 110 has a larger width at both ends in the longitudinal direction where the lower protrusion 113 is formed than the central portion.

At least one slit 111b formed in the lower portion of the body member 110 is formed in the lower protrusion 113 as well. The slit 111b is formed so that the lower end of the lower protrusion 113 is also cut. The lower protrusion 113 is positioned forward of the neck when worn. As the lower protrusion 113 is formed, the lower protrusion 113 can cover the clavicle portion of the body without falling down to the shoulder when worn, And the comfort is improved.

As shown in FIG. 4, the body member 110 may further include an upper protrusion 115. The upper projection 115 protrudes upward in a part of the longitudinal direction at both longitudinal ends of the body member 110. The body member 110 has a larger width at both longitudinal ends where the upper protrusion 115 is formed than the central portion.

At least one slit 111a formed in the upper portion of the body member 110 is formed in the upper protrusion 115 as well. The slit 111a is formed so that the upper end of the upper protrusion 115 is also cut. As the upper protrusion 115 is formed, the upper protrusion 115 is not brought into contact with the ear when worn, and the front portion of the jaw is supported, thereby reducing the pressure feeling and improving the wearing comfort.

In the cover member 130  .

The cover member 130 is composed of a flexible sheet-like cover part 131 provided to surround the body member 110. The cover part 131 is formed of two layers to surround the body member 110. The cover 131 may cover the entire body 110 or may surround a part of the body 110 to expose a part of the body 110.

The cover member 131 may be folded into two pieces and the body member 110 may be inserted to cover the cover member 131 and the cover member 131 and the body member 110 It may be manufactured by integrally staking. The cover part 131 may be folded in two, and a zipper may be provided at a part of the cover part 131 to insert the body member 110 into the zippered part.

When the cover part 131 and the body member 110 are integrally formed, the deformation of the part where the slits 111a and 111b are formed is not suppressed at the part where the slits 111a and 111b formed in the body member 110 are formed It is preferable to prevent stitching. The cover member 131 can be manufactured by wrapping the body member 110 with the cover member 131 and staking along the longitudinal direction at the center.

The cover member 131 covers the body member 110 so that both ends of the cover member 131 abut or partially overlap with each other along the longitudinal direction at the center in the width direction, And the cover portion 131, the body member 110, and the extension member 133 may be integrally stitched along the longitudinal direction.

The material forming the cover part 131 is more flexible than the material forming the body member 110. The material of the cover 131 is thinner than the material of the body 110.

The cover 131 may be a cloth. The cover 131 is made of a material having good stretchability such as spandex (hereinafter referred to as "stretchable material"). It is preferable to use a stretchable material having a stretchability of 20% or more.

Specific examples of the material constituting the cover part 131 include spandex velvet sold under the trade name "Velvet-Jean Red" (seller: Chunmart).

 The cover 131 may be made of a material having a good stretchability (hereinafter referred to as "stretchable material").

When a part of the cover part 131 is made of an elastic material, the cover part 131 is provided to cover at least a part of the protrusions. When a part of the cover part 131 is made of a stretchable material, the stretchable material part is provided so as to surround the upper protrusion and the lower protrusion. The elastic part of the cover part 131 is provided to cover all or a part of the upper protrusions and is provided to cover all or a part of the lower protrusions. As described above, when the upper protrusions are worn, the cover protrusions 131 are deformed so that the distance between the ends of the slits 111a and 111b are shifted away from each other and the cover portion 131 surrounding the upper protrusions and the lower protrusions is stretched and elastically supported. Therefore, it is preferable that at least a part of the upper protrusions be wrapped in the stretchable material portion.

When a part of the cover 131 is made of a stretchable material, the inside can be made of a stretchable material. When the neck support 100 is worn, the inner side faces the skin side. When the neck support 100 is worn, the upper and lower protrusions are deformed outward, the upper protrusions and the lower protrusions are pushed outward and the end portions of the slits 111a and 111b are deformed away from each other, It is preferable that the portion located on the inner surface side is made of a stretchable material so that tensile force is generated in the cover portion 131 of the side of the cover portion 131 on the side A portion covering at least a part of the front surface of the upper protrusions and a portion covering at least a part of the front surface of the lower protrusions may be made of a stretchable material.

Since the slits 111a and 111b are formed in the body member 110 so as to have a plurality of upper protrusions and a lower protrusion at the upper and lower portions thereof, The cover portion 131 is elastically deformed to support the body contact portion so as to wrap the body portion, so that the feeling of comfort is improved while supporting the body portion.

The connecting members 150 are provided at both ends in the longitudinal direction. The connecting member 150 may be formed of a velcro or a snap which is detachably coupled to the connecting member 150. One of the velcro and the snap button that is detachably coupled to each other is provided at one end in the longitudinal direction and the other is provided at the other end in the longitudinal direction so as to be worn on the neck and to connect the connecting members 150 at both ends . One of the connecting members 150 is attached to the inside and the other is attached to the outside.

The cover member 131 is provided to surround the body member 110 so that the connection member 150 can be formed by a method of being stuck on the cover member 131 or the like. When the cover part 131 is provided so as to surround a part of the body member 110, the connection member 150 may be coupled to the cover part 131 or may be coupled to the exposed body member 110 .

The connecting member 150 may be a string member. When the connecting member 150 is provided as a cord member, the connecting member 150 is provided at the longitudinal end of the cover member 130, respectively. It can be worn by tying string members at both ends when worn.

The connecting member 150 serves to connect both longitudinal ends of the neck support 100. The connecting members 150 are coupled to each other so that the neck support 100 according to the present invention is formed as a closed circuit.

The cover member 130 may further include an extension member 133 coupled to the cover unit 131. The extension member 133 is provided to protrude longitudinally at one longitudinal end of the cover 131. The extension member 133 is provided so as to be located on the outer side.

The extension member 133 is made of a flexible sheet-like material. An example of the extending member 133 is cloth. The width of the extension member 133 is smaller than the width of the body member 110, and is provided so as to be positioned at the center in the width direction.

When the extension member 133 is provided at one longitudinal end portion of the cover portion 131, one of the connection members 150 is provided at the protruding portion of the extension member 133, And may be provided to the body member 110 when the body member 110 is exposed.

The extension member 133 may extend along the longitudinal direction of the cover part 131 at the center in the width direction and protrude from one longitudinal end of the cover part 131. The other end of the extension member 133 is substantially aligned with the other end of the cover 131. The end portion of the extension member 133 and the end portion of the cover portion 131 coincide with each other and include a small separation distance between the end portion of the extension member 133 and the end portion of the cover portion 131, The extension member 133 may be stitched together with the cover 131 and the body member 110 along the longitudinal direction of the cover 131 at the center in the width direction. In this case, one of the connecting members 150 is provided on the protruding portion of the extending member 133, and the other is provided on the extending member 133 on the opposite end in the longitudinal direction.

The neck base 100 according to the present invention has a slit formed in the body member 110 to facilitate its deformation. The cover member 130 is made of a stretchable material and is stretched to elastically support the deformation of the body member 110 Support your neck comfortably. 9, it is possible to fold and carry.
